How to Handle Recovery Situations Involving Hazardous Materials Safely

Handling recovery situations involving hazardous materials requires careful planning and adherence to safety protocols. Proper procedures help protect responders, the environment, and the public from potential harm.

Understanding Hazardous Materials

Hazardous materials, or hazmat, include chemicals, biological agents, radioactive substances, and other dangerous materials. Recognizing these substances is crucial for effective and safe recovery efforts.

Types of Hazardous Materials

  • Chemicals (acids, solvents, pesticides)
  • Biological agents (bacteria, viruses)
  • Radioactive materials
  • Explosives and flammable liquids

Safety Precautions During Recovery

Implementing safety measures is vital to prevent accidents and exposure. Always follow established protocols and use appropriate protective equipment.

Personal Protective Equipment (PPE)

  • Hazmat suits
  • Gloves and boots
  • Respirators or masks
  • Eye protection (goggles or face shields)

Safe Handling Procedures

  • Identify and assess the hazard before beginning recovery
  • Use proper containers and labeling for hazardous waste
  • Avoid direct contact with the material
  • Ensure proper ventilation in the area

Emergency Response and Decontamination

In case of exposure or spills, quick and effective response is essential. Decontamination procedures help minimize health risks and environmental damage.

Spill Response

  • Isolate the spill area
  • Use absorbent materials designed for hazardous spills
  • Notify emergency services immediately
  • Follow decontamination protocols for personnel

Decontamination Procedures

  • Remove contaminated clothing
  • Wash exposed skin with soap and water
  • Use specialized decontamination solutions if necessary
  • Properly dispose of contaminated materials
